The injectors are numbered according to the firing order (e.g. injector No.2 is located at
cylinder No.3). On the 1.4 MZ-CD engine the cylinder No.1 is located next to the
transmission (French-style cylinder numbering).

Intake-air System
•
In order to comply with Euro 4 emission legislation, the intake-air system of the
1.4 MZ-CD Diesel engine of the Mazda2 Facelift has been revised as follows:
–
MAP (Manifold Absolute Pressure) sensor has been added
–
new hot film-type MAF (Mass Air Flow) sensor (instead of hot wire-type) with
integrated IAT (Intake Air Temperature) sensor
–
additional IAT sensor
–
ISV (Intake Shutter Valve) has been introduced for upgrading the EGR system
•
The operation of MAP sensor, MAF sensor, IAT sensor and the actuation of the ISV can
be monitored using the Datalogger function of the WDS (Worldwide Diagnostic System).

Exhaust Gas Recirculation System
•
For meeting the Euro 4 emission regulations the exhaust gas recirculation system of the
Mazda2 Facelift with 1.4 MZ-CD Diesel engine has the following new features:
–
EGR valve with DC (Direct Current) motor and position sensor
–
EGR cooler
–
ISV with DC motor
EGR Valve
•
For more precise exhaust gas admeasurement the previous pneumatic EGR valve has
been replaced by an electrically operated EGR valve.
•
The EGR valve is located at the rear side of the engine and is connected to the exhaust
manifold via an EGR duct integrated in the cylinder head.
•
It uses a DC motor for actuation. A cam plate transforms the rotational movement of the
motor into an axial movement of the EGR valve. An EGRVP (EGR Valve Position)
sensor is installed for monitoring the valve position.

•
The position of the EGR valve is controlled by the PCM, which activates the DC motor
via a duty signal.

•
At low engine speed the PCM controls the DC motor with a large duty cycle, so that the
EGR valve opens and exhaust gas is recirculated.
•
At high engine speed the PCM controls the DC motor with a small duty cycle, so that the
EGR valve closes and no exhaust gas is recirculated.
•
In order to remove any carbon deposits from the EGR valve seat a cleaning mode is
activated each time the ignition is switched off. Therefore, the PCM actuates the EGR
valve so that it is moved from the fully open position to the fully closed position several
times. This process takes approx. 30 s.
NOTE: If the engine coolant temperature is below -5°C, the EGR cleaning mode is cancelled
as the EGR valve could be frozen and would not move.
